Sunday 24 Dec 2006
 
Got to Bequia at 06:30 in the morning after one of the fastest trip we have ever done. It was pretty wet at times and kept us all awake, changing sails and looking after the boat. We rounded into Admiralty Bay just as dawn was breaking and hunted around for a decent anchorage which we found close to the shore. The wind was still blowing hard and we had to have a couple of goes at anchoring. First on the Agenda was a sleep for us all and then Paul went ashore to clear through customs and immigration.
 
Andrew brought a Christmas CD with him and after snorkeling around the boat for a while we put the CD on and listened to White Christmas (it's 30 deg outside), ate Lebkuchen, drank beer and out the christmas decorations up. Only one last thing to do now before we settle in for Christmas evening and that is .... you guessed it ..... fix the generator!!!
